## Releases

Bouncewright, our email bounce processor, cuts a release every second Friday, aligned with the weekly eng sync. Each release is tagged, built reproducibly, and signed before publication to the internal registry. Please verify signatures rather than trusting tags alone. Verification should be done against the current release key below.

signing key of hahag-tahag = bky4_v18e

## Turnstile Upgrade — Harlowe Annex

Night shift: the east lobby turnstiles were swapped to the new Gatewyn units on Monday. Old badges no longer scan there. Use the west lane until re-enrollment is done. Tailgating alarms are live; one person per rotation. If a unit jams, power-cycle from the panel behind the guard desk, not the wall switch. Report faults to Facilities by log sheet, not radio. Until your new badge arrives, use the interim pass below at the west lane.

door code, fajog-fajeg: bdg-QJKCM-2

Subject: TilePrime prefetcher cut-over complete

Plugin authors: the TilePrime map-tile prefetcher is now live on the Verran grid stack. Old prefetch hooks are gone; use the v3 callback signature or your plugin will silently no-op. Cache warm-up windows shortened, so test against staging before Friday. The active service configuration values follow below for reference.

deployment values, hahip-kajep:
HOLAX_PIN=4003
HOLAX_METRICS_HOST=metrics.holax.zemvarworks.internal
HOLAX_LOG_LEVEL=warn
HOLAX_TENANT=fraael

**Leadership Review Briefing — Legacy Pricing**

Quick heads-up before Thursday's review: we're moving legacy Brightvale customers off the old Classic Plan rates starting next quarter. Most have been paying 2019 prices, and support costs on those accounts keep climbing. The bump is modest — roughly 8% — with a 60-day notice window so nobody's blindsided. Expect a few grumbles at the Kellsford and Marrow Bay branches. Talking points are drafted and will circulate Monday. One more thing to flag before we wrap.

management briefing: Project Ulavan slips by two quarters because of the staffing delay.